From 37ae4739bc8277539b16fbcf5294f19b082d5c79 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Aaron Sawdey Date: Mon, 26 Nov 2018 20:59:06 +0000 Subject: [PATCH] rs6000-string.c (expand_cmp_vec_sequence): Rename and modify expand_strncmp_vec_sequence. 2018-11-26 Aaron Sawdey * config/rs6000/rs6000-string.c (expand_cmp_vec_sequence): Rename and modify expand_strncmp_vec_sequence. (emit_final_compare_vec): Rename and modify emit_final_str_compare_vec. (generate_6432_conversion): New function. (expand_block_compare): Add support for vsx. (expand_block_compare_gpr): New function. * config/rs6000/rs6000.opt (rs6000_block_compare_inline_limit): Increase default limit to 63 because of more compact vsx code.
